unwind_symbols Список адресов и имен функций в файле ELF Тип файла: команда usage: unwind_symbols <ELF_FILE> [<FUNC_ADDRESS>] ELF_FILE - путь к файлу ELF FUNC_ADDRESS - получить функцию по указанному адресу FUNC_ADDRESS должен быть шестнадцатеричным числом. Сообщения о типе процессора (elf.machine_type): "ABI: arm" "ABI: arm64" "ABI: x86" "ABI: x86_64" "ABI: unknown" ( ABI = application binary interface) Комментарии console:/ # unwind_symbols /bin/ls ABI: arm <0x22558> Function: _start <0x22568> Function: _start_main <0x2259c> Function: get_optflags <0x22b18> Function: gotflag <0x22e1c> Function: comma_args <0x22ecc> Function: comma_iterate <0x22f04> Function: comma_collate <0x22f58> Function: comma_scan <0x23020> Function: comma_scanall <0x23098> Function: comma_remove <0x2312c> Function: isdotdot <0x23148> Function: dirtree_notdotdot <0x23170> Function: dirtree_add_node <0x23320> Function: dirtree_path <0x233c2> Function: dirtree_parentfd <0x233d0> Function: dirtree_recurse <0x234a8> Function: dirtree_handle_callback <0x2351a> Function: dirtree_flagread <0x23532> Function: dirtree_read <0x2354c> Function: environ_bytes <0x2357c> Function: xclearenv <0x235d8> Function: xsetenv <0x23738> Function: xunsetenv <0x23760> Function: show_help <0x23844> Function: verror_msg <0x238e0> Function: error_msg <0x2391c> Function: perror_msg <0x23960> Function: error_exit <0x2397c> Function: perror_exit <0x239a4> Function: help_exit <0x239e0> Function: perror_msg_raw <0x239f0> Function: perror_exit_raw <0x23a00> Function: readall <0x23a36> Function: writeall <0x23a64> Function: lskip <0x23b38> Function: mkpathat <0x23c70> Function: mkpath <0x23c7e> Function: splitpath <0x23ce8> Function: find_in_path <0x23df0> Function: _ZL7sprintfPcU17pass_object_size1PKcz <0x23e30> Function: estrtol <0x23e50> Function: xstrtol <0x23e84> Function: atolx <0x23fbc> Function: atolx_range <0x24008> Function: stridx <0x24020> Function: utf8towc <0x24108> Function: strlower <0x241d8> Function: strafter <0x241f2> Function: chomp <0x2420c> Function: unescape <0x24230> Function: unescape2 <0x24324> Function: strend <0x24354> Function: strstart <0x2437c> Function: strcasestart <0x243a8> Function: fdlength <0x244ec> Function: readfd <0x245d8> Function: readfileat <0x24604> Function: readfile <0x2463c> Function: msleep <0x24690> Function: nanodiff <0x246ac> Function: highest_bit <0x246c0> Function: peek <0x2470a> Function: peek_be <0x2472e> Function: poke <0x24748> Function: loopfiles_rw <0x247e8> Function: loopfiles <0x247f8> Function: loopfiles_lines <0x24870> Function: get_line <0x248ec> Function: wfchmodat <0x24920> Function: copy_tempfile <0x249bc> Function: sigatexit <0x24a08> Function: tempfile_handler <0x24a1c> Function: delete_tempfile <0x24a50> Function: replace_tempfile <0x24ab0> Function: crc_init <0x24b06> Function: base64_init <0x24b34> Function: yesno <0x24b48> Function: fyesno <0x24c04> Function: generic_signal <0x24c48> Function: exit_signal <0x24c60> Function: list_signals <0x24cd4> Function: string_to_mode <0x24f18> Function: mode_to_string <0x24fb8> Function: getbasename <0x24fcc> Function: fileunderdir <0x25034> Function: relative_path <0x250e4> Function: names_to_pid <0x2530c> Function: human_readable_long <0x25440> Function: _ZL8snprintfPcU17pass_object_size1jPKcz <0x25480> Function: human_readable <0x2549e> Function: qstrcmp <0x254a6> Function: create_uuid <0x254c8> Function: show_uuid <0x2551c> Function: next_printf <0x2557c> Function: bufgetpwuid <0x25620> Function: bufgetgrgid <0x256c4> Function: readlinkat0 <0x256ea> Function: readlink0 <0x256f8> Function: regexec0 <0x2574c> Function: getusername <0x25778> Function: getgroupname <0x257a4> Function: do_lines <0x25850> Function: millitime <0x258a4> Function: format_iso_time <0x25908> Function: tar_cksum <0x25928> Function: is_tar_header <0x259b8> Function: elf_arch_name <0x259fc> Function: crunch_str <0x25acc> Function: crunch_escape <0x25b48> Function: _ZL7sprintfPcU17pass_object_size1PKcz <0x25b88> Function: crunch_rev_escape <0x25bb8> Function: utf8len <0x25bf4> Function: draw_trim_esc <0x25cd4> Function: draw_trim <0x25ce0> Function: llist_free_double <0x25cf4> Function: llist_traverse <0x25d08> Function: llist_pop <0x25d12> Function: dlist_pop <0x25d3a> Function: dlist_lpop <0x25d6e> Function: dlist_add_nomalloc <0x25d8e> Function: dlist_add <0x25dbc> Function: dlist_terminate <0x25dd6> Function: get_num_cache <0x25df6> Function: add_num_cache <0x25e40> Function: xsocket <0x25e70> Function: xsetsockopt <0x25e94> Function: xgetaddrinfo <0x25f4c> Function: xconnectany <0x25f54> Function: xconnbind <0x26040> Function: xbindany <0x26048> Function: xbind <0x26060> Function: xconnect <0x26078> Function: xpoll <0x260d8> Function: pollinate <0x261b0> Function: ntop <0x261dc> Function: xsendto <0x2620c> Function: xfork <0x26228> Function: xgetrandom <0x2626c> Function: mountlist_istype <0x2632c> Function: xgetmountlist <0x2643c> Function: octal_deslash <0x26484> Function: xnotify_init <0x264c0> Function: xnotify_add <0x26518> Function: xnotify_wait <0x265a0> Function: xattr_fget <0x265a4> Function: xattr_flist <0x265a8> Function: xattr_fset <0x265ac> Function: xsignal_all_killers <0x265d4> Function: sig_to_num <0x266b8> Function: num_to_sig <0x26764> Function: _ZL7sprintfPcU17pass_object_size1PKcz <0x267ac> Function: dev_minor <0x267b6> Function: dev_major <0x267bc> Function: dev_makedev <0x267dc> Function: fs_type_name <0x26820> Function: get_block_device_size <0x26838> Function: sendfile_len <0x2690c> Function: tty_fd <0x26950> Function: terminal_size <0x26a14> Function: terminal_probesize <0x26a40> Function: xsetspeed <0x26a78> Function: set_terminal <0x26b50> Function: _ZL7sprintfPcU17pass_object_size1PKcz <0x26b90> Function: scan_key_getsize <0x26d68> Function: scan_key <0x26d70> Function: tty_esc <0x26d80> Function: tty_jump <0x26dd8> Function: tty_reset <0x26e70> Function: tty_sigreset <0x26e84> Function: start_redraw <0x26eec> Function: xstrncpy <0x26f1c> Function: _xexit <0x26f38> Function: xexit <0x26f6c> Function: xflush <0x26fac> Function: xmmap <0x26fd8> Function: xmalloc <0x26ff4> Function: xzalloc <0x27008> Function: xrealloc <0x27020> Function: xstrndup <0x27038> Function: xstrdup <0x27058> Function: xmemdup <0x27074> Function: xmprintf <0x270d4> Function: xprintf <0x27114> Function: xputsl <0x2713c> Function: xwrite <0x27158> Function: xputsn <0x2716c> Function: xputs <0x2717c> Function: xputc <0x271a8> Function: xpopen_both <0x271b0> Function: xopen_stdio <0x271f0> Function: xvforkwrap <0x27218> Function: xexec <0x2725c> Function: xpopen_setup <0x2736c> Function: xwaitpid <0x273c0> Function: xpclose_both <0x273e0> Function: xpopen <0x2743c> Function: xpclose <0x27450> Function: xrun <0x27464> Function: xunlink <0x27480> Function: xpipe <0x27498> Function: xclose <0x274b4> Function: xdup <0x274d8> Function: notstdio <0x27524> Function: xrename <0x27544> Function: xtempfile <0x27578> Function: xcreate <0x275bc> Function: xopen <0x27600> Function: openro <0x27628> Function: xopenro <0x27630> Function: xfdopen <0x27648> Function: xfopen <0x27664> Function: xread <0x27684> Function: xreadall <0x276a0> Function: xlseek <0x276c4> Function: xgetcwd <0x276e0> Function: xstat <0x276fc> Function: xabspath <0x279a8> Function: xchdir <0x279c4> Function: xgetpwuid <0x279e0> Function: xgetgrgid <0x279fc> Function: xgetuid <0x27a60> Function: xgetgid <0x27ac4> Function: xreadlink <0x27b14> Function: xreadfile <0x27b30> Function: xioctl <0x27b68> Function: xsendfile_len <0x27bc8> Function: xsendfile_pad <0x27c4c> Function: xsendfile <0x27c64> Function: xstrtod <0x27cb8> Function: xparsetime <0x27dc0> Function: xparsemillitime <0x27e00> Function: xregcomp <0x27e4c> Function: xtzset <0x27e98> Function: xsignal_flags <0x27ed4> Function: xsignal <0x27edc> Function: xvali_date <0x27f1c> Function: xparsedate <0x2822c> Function: xmktime <0x2827c> Function: toybox_main <0x28404> Function: toy_find <0x284b0> Function: toy_singleinit <0x285f8> Function: toy_init <0x28650> Function: toy_exec_which <0x28688> Function: main <0x286d4> Function: gzip_main <0x28734> Function: do_gzip <0x28a24> Function: gunzip_main <0x28a3c> Function: zcat_main <0x28a54> Function: _ZL7sprintfPcU17pass_object_size1PKcz <0x28aa4> Function: hostname_main <0x28ba8> Function: _ZL8snprintfPcU17pass_object_size1jPKcz <0x28be8> Function: md5sum_main <0x28e1c> Function: do_hash <0x28f28> Function: sha1sum_main <0x28f2c> Function: _ZL7sprintfPcU17pass_object_size1PKcz <0x28f70> Function: mktemp_main <0x29164> Function: seq_main <0x2948c> Function: parsef <0x294c8> Function: _ZL8snprintfPcU17pass_object_size1jPKcz <0x29508> Function: itoa <0x2958c> Function: microcom_main <0x29724> Function: restore_states <0x29750> Function: dos2unix_main <0x29768> Function: do_dos2unix <0x29850> Function: unix2dos_main <0x29868> Function: readlink_main <0x298d0> Function: realpath_main <0x298e8> Function: setsid_main <0x29980> Function: stat_main <0x2a11c> Function: timeout_main <0x2a204> Function: handler <0x2a290> Function: truncate_main <0x2a2fc> Function: do_truncate <0x2a3a0> Function: which_main <0x2a49c> Function: xxd_main <0x2a514> Function: do_xxd_reverse <0x2a708> Function: do_xxd_include <0x2a7c4> Function: do_xxd <0x2a940> Function: yes_main <0x2a98c> Function: dd_main <0x2af74> Function: parse_flags <0x2afe4> Function: dd_sigint <0x2affc> Function: write_out <0x2b088> Function: status <0x2b1c0> Function: bcomp <0x2b1d4> Function: quote_filename <0x2b2d0> Function: _ZL7sprintfPcU17pass_object_size1PKcz <0x2b314> Function: diff_main <0x2b794> Function: show_status <0x2b7e8> Function: list_dir <0x2b8e0> Function: cmp <0x2b8e8> Function: concat_file_path <0x2b938> Function: do_diff <0x2bec4> Function: add_to_list <0x2bf14> Function: create_empty_entry <0x2c154> Function: show_label <0x2c1c4> Function: print_diff <0x2c2e0> Function: create_j_vector <0x2c784> Function: read_tok <0x2c8a8> Function: comp <0x2c8c4> Function: get_int <0x2c918> Function: eval_op <0x2cc54> Function: expr_main <0x2cd00> Function: eval_expr <0x2ce30> Function: getopt_main <0x2d044> Function: parse_long_opt <0x2d088> Function: out <0x2d0e8> Function: tr_main <0x2d308> Function: expand_set <0x2d5f8> Function: basename_main <0x2d678> Function: cat_main <0x2d690> Function: do_cat <0x2d7a0> Function: chmod_main <0x2d7dc> Function: do_chmod <0x2d86c> Function: cmp_main <0x2d8b0> Function: do_cmp <0x2d9c8> Function: comm_main <0x2dadc> Function: writeline <0x2db48> Function: cp_main <0x2df04> Function: cp_node <0x2e5c0> Function: mv_main <0x2e5d8> Function: install_main <0x2e6fc> Function: install_node <0x2e790> Function: cpio_main <0x2ef0c> Function: strpad <0x2ef3c> Function: x8u <0x2efb4> Function: cut_main <0x2f15c> Function: _ZL7sprintfPcU17pass_object_size1PKcz <0x2f1a0> Function: get_range <0x2f288> Function: compar <0x2f2b0> Function: cut_line <0x2f534> Function: date_main <0x2f808> Function: parse_date <0x2f8c0> Function: _ZL7sprintfPcU17pass_object_size1PKcz <0x2f904> Function: dirname_main <0x2f92c> Function: du_main <0x2f9a8> Function: do_du <0x2fb2c> Function: print <0x2fc28> Function: echo_main <0x2fd08> Function: env_main <0x2fdbc> Function: find_main <0x2fea8> Function: do_find <0x30f9c> Function: execdir <0x3101c> Function: do_print <0x31044> Function: compare_numsign <0x310c4> Function: flush_exec <0x311d4> Function: _ZL7sprintfPcU17pass_object_size1PKcz <0x31218> Function: getconf_main <0x313c0> Function: show_conf <0x31470> Function: grep_main <0x31788> Function: do_grep <0x31e88> Function: do_grep_r <0x31f90> Function: outline <0x320a8> Function: head_main <0x320f4> Function: do_head <0x321d8> Function: id_main <0x32208> Function: do_id <0x3252c> Function: groups_main <0x32550> Function: logname_main <0x32568> Function: showone <0x325a8> Function: ln_main <0x3282c> Function: ls_main <0x329dc> Function: listfiles console:/ # 130|console:/ # unwind_symbols /bin/ls 0x23a36 ABI: arm <0x23a36>: writeall console:/ # |